Salman Khan's 'Jai Ho' failed at the box-office

A hugely awaited film prior to release, Salman Khan’sJai Ho’ has failed to live up to the mammoth expectations the actor generated. The box office collections have failed to make its mark in the Bollywood business records. Although competing with ‘Dhoom 3’, barely a month after the film’s release was certainly not an easy task, Salman Khan’s name failed to create much of a furore at the Box Office. The Khan vs Khan battle ended in a dud with no Salman posing competition whatsoever.

When comparing ‘Jai Ho’ to Salman’s earlier releases too, ‘Jai Ho’ has failed miserably with an opening weekend figure of Rs. 60.68 crore. The performance of his last three films were:

1. ‘Bodyguard’ (2011) – Rs. 88.75 crore

2. ‘Ek Tha Tiger’ (2012) – Rs. 100.16 crore

3. ‘Dabanng 2’ (2012) – Rs. 65 crore

On the other hand, ‘Dhoom 3’ had an astounding Rs. 174.98 crore during first six days of business at the Box Office, Hrithik Roshan’s ‘Krrish 3’ did a whopping Rs. 153.08 crore and Shah Rukh Khan’s ‘Chennai Express’ did a Rs. 130.35 crore.

About ‘Jai Ho’, trade analyst Taran Adarsh tweeted yesterday, ‘#JaiHo Wknd 60.68 crore, Mon 9.50 crore, Tue 7.30 crore, Wed 5.80 crore. Total: Rs. 83.28 crore nett. Indian biz only’.

The heartening news for the movie is that it has managed to slip into the elite Rs. 100 crore club thanks to its overseas collections. Albeit a slow start in the international audience, word of mouth helped the film pick up and fare exceptionally well in the UAE – GCC region, Pakistan and USA – Canada collecting a decent Rs. 22.38 crore. Overall, the collection till Wednesday was a Rs. 4.5 million (Rs. 28.20 crore). In Pakistan, the film collected Rs. 2.21 crore in the opening weekend.

With no competition to provide to ‘Dhoom 3’ which had the highest opening day domestic box office collections of Rs. 36.22 crore, ‘Jai Ho’ managed a meagre Rs. 17.75 crore on its opening day. Although January 26 saw the film collecting Rs. 26 crore, it could not sustain it the next day.Salman Khan took to Twitter to thank his fans for their support after taking the blame earlier for the low performance of the film at the Box Office. According to what film trade analyst Komal Nahta has to say, the film has already made a profit of Rs. 100 crore. She said, ‘For all those asking, Salman and Sohail have made Rs. 100 crore profit in JAI HO.’
